Niagara man arrested for various felonies, including sexual assault of a child

Marinette County Sheriff's Office

NIAGARA, WI— A man who was involved in a standoff with police in Niagara, Wisconsin Monday has been arrested on multiple charges, including sexual assault of a child.

WBAY-TV says police tried to arrest Joshua Otto, 43, at his home Monday evening, but he barricaded himself inside. When officers entered the house, Otto was gone.

Police arrested Otto Wednesday at an abandoned cabin near a rural town road. He’s lodged in the Marinette County Jail on charges of sexual assault of a child, child enticement, felony bail jumping, resisting/obstructing law enforcement, and felony and misdemeanor drug charges.

Officials say additional charges are pending completion of the investigation.
